Foundation Moisture Control in Grand Rapids, MI
Foundation moisture control services focus on managing excess moisture around a property's foundation to prevent issues such as cracking, shifting, or water intrusion. These services typically include installing drainage systems, waterproofing membranes, or vapor barriers to help regulate soil moisture levels and protect the foundation from water damage. Projects may involve addressing existing moisture problems or implementing preventative measures during new construction or renovation to ensure the stability and longevity of the foundation.
Homeowners often seek foundation moisture control to safeguard their property against basement flooding, mold growth, and structural deterioration caused by excessive or uneven moisture. Common Foundation Moisture Control Jobs
Foundation Waterproofing - helps prevent water intrusion that can weaken the foundation over time.
Drainage Solutions - directs excess water away from the foundation to reduce moisture buildup.
Moisture Barriers - installed to block ground moisture from seeping into basement or crawl spaces.
Sump Pump Installation - removes accumulated water to protect below-grade areas from flooding.
Crack Repair - seals foundation cracks to prevent water entry and further damage.
Vapor Barrier Installation - reduces humidity and controls moisture levels inside basements and crawl spaces.
Foundation Moisture Control Questions
What is foundation moisture control? It involves managing water around a building’s foundation to prevent issues like leaks, mold, and structural damage.
Why is moisture control important for foundations? Proper moisture management helps maintain the integrity of the foundation and reduces the risk of costly repairs caused by excess water or dryness.
What types of moisture control solutions are available? Solutions include drainage systems, vapor barriers, and sump pumps designed to keep soil moisture levels balanced around the foundation.
How can I tell if my foundation needs moisture control? Signs include damp or moldy basement walls, uneven flooring, or cracks in the foundation that may indicate moisture problems.
